浙教版(2023)信息科技六上 第7课 猜数字算法验证 教案.docx

浙教版(2023)信息科技六上 第7课 猜数字算法验证 教案.docx

  1. 1、本文档共6页,可阅读全部内容。
  2. 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

浙教版(2023)信息科技六上第7课猜数字算法验证教案

科目

授课时间节次

--年—月—日(星期——)第—节

指导教师

授课班级、授课课时

授课题目

(包括教材及章节名称)

浙教版(2023)信息科技六上第7课猜数字算法验证教案

教材分析

浙教版(2023)信息科技六上第7课“猜数字算法验证”教案

教学内容:

本节课主要内容是让学生掌握猜数字游戏的算法,通过编写程序验证算法的正确性。学生需要理解算法的基本思想,并能运用程序设计语言实现猜数字游戏。

教学目标:

1.理解猜数字游戏的基本原理。

2.学会使用程序设计语言编写猜数字游戏。

3.通过实践,掌握算法验证的方法。

教学重点:

1.猜数字游戏的基本原理。

2.程序设计语言的基本语法。

3.算法验证的方法。

教学难点:

1.算法的设计与实现。

2.算法验证的方法。

教学准备:

1.程序设计语言的环境。

2.与猜数字游戏相关的教学素材。

教学过程:

1.导入:通过一个小游戏引入猜数字游戏的主题。

2.新课:讲解猜数字游戏的基本原理,引导学生思考如何设计算法。

3.实践:学生分组进行编程实践,编写猜数字游戏。

4.验证:学生通过运行程序,验证猜数字游戏的正确性。

5.总结:对本节课的内容进行总结,布置课后作业。

教学反思:

核心素养目标

本节课的核心素养目标包括:

1.计算思维:培养学生运用计算机科学的方法和思维解决实际问题的能力,学会从问题和需求出发,设计并实现猜数字游戏的算法。

2.信息素养:培养学生收集、处理、利用信息的能力,学会使用程序设计语言进行编程实践,掌握猜数字游戏的编写和调试方法。

3.创新与实践:培养学生创新意识和实践能力,鼓励学生在编写猜数字游戏的过程中,发挥自己的创意,优化算法,提高游戏的趣味性和挑战性。

4.团队合作:培养学生分工合作、协同解决问题的能力,通过分组实践,学会与他人合作,共同完成猜数字游戏的编写和验证。

重点难点及解决办法

重点:

1.猜数字游戏的基本原理。

2.算法的设计与实现。

3.算法验证的方法。

难点:

1.算法的设计与实现。

2.算法验证的方法。

解决办法:

1.对于猜数字游戏的基本原理,通过具体案例的讲解和分析,让学生理解和掌握。

2.对于算法的设计与实现,引导学生从问题和需求出发,逐步引导学生设计算法,并在课堂上进行实践和调试。

3.对于算法验证的方法,通过实例演示和引导学生动手实践,让学生掌握算法验证的方法和技巧。

突破策略:

1.针对算法的复杂度,引导学生学会分析问题,将问题分解为更小的子问题,逐步解决。

2.引导学生学会利用程序设计语言的基本语法和功能,实现猜数字游戏的算法。

3.在课堂上,鼓励学生提问和分享,促进学生之间的交流和合作,共同解决问题。

教学方法与手段

教学方法:

1.讲授法:通过讲解猜数字游戏的基本原理和算法,让学生理解和掌握相关知识。

2.实验法:让学生动手实践编写猜数字游戏,培养学生的实际操作能力和解决问题的能力。

3.讨论法:分组进行讨论,鼓励学生分享自己的想法和解决问题的方法,促进学生之间的交流和合作。

教学手段:

1.多媒体设备:利用多媒体设备展示猜数字游戏的示例和算法过程,增强学生的理解和记忆。

2.教学软件:使用教学软件辅助教学,提供编程环境和调试工具,方便学生进行实践和验证。

3.网络资源:利用网络资源提供更多的猜数字游戏案例和实践素材,丰富学生的学习资源和思路。

教学过程

课前准备:

学生在上课前需要了解一些基本的程序设计概念和语法,熟悉使用计算机编程环境。我会提前准备好相关的教学素材和示例程序,以便在课堂上进行演示和练习。

课堂导入:

我会在课堂上通过一个简单的猜数字游戏引入本节课的主题。我会向学生介绍猜数字游戏的规则和基本思路,然后展示一个我提前准备好的猜数字游戏程序,让学生亲身体验一下游戏的乐趣。

新课讲解:

在学生对猜数字游戏有了初步了解之后,我会开始讲解猜数字游戏的基本原理和算法。我会通过示例和图解的方式,向学生讲解如何设计和实现猜数字游戏的算法。我会讲解如何生成一个随机数,如何根据用户的输入判断猜测是否正确,以及如何根据用户的猜测给出提示信息。

实践环节:

在讲解完猜数字游戏的算法之后,我会让学生分组进行实践。每组学生需要使用程序设计语言编写一个猜数字游戏程序,并运行程序进行验证。我会提供一些参考资料和示例代码,以帮助学生理解和实现算法。

在实践过程中,我会鼓励学生积极思考和讨论,遇到问题时可以相互帮助和解决。我会巡回指导,对学生的程序进行检查和调试,提供必要的帮助和建议。

验证环节:

完成程序编写后,我会让学生运行程序,进行猜数字游戏的验证。学生可以通过输入自己猜测的数字,观察程序的输出结

您可能关注的文档

文档评论(0)

文档收藏爱好者 + 关注
官方认证
内容提供者

事业编考题需要答案请私聊我发答案

认证主体莲池区卓方网络服务部
IP属地河北
统一社会信用代码/组织机构代码
92130606MA0GFXTU34

1亿VIP精品文档

相关文档